From 96b431de559c441613b0e12f2a780308b0f9721c Mon Sep 17 00:00:00 2001 From: Oliver Davies Date: Sun, 27 Jul 2025 23:27:36 +0100 Subject: [PATCH] Move redshift configuration --- hosts/t490/services/redshift.nix | 31 ------------------------------- modules/home-manager/default.nix | 1 - modules/home-manager/redshift.nix | 19 ------------------- modules2/redshift.nix | 8 ++++++++ 4 files changed, 8 insertions(+), 51 deletions(-) delete mode 100644 hosts/t490/services/redshift.nix delete mode 100644 modules/home-manager/redshift.nix create mode 100644 modules2/redshift.nix diff --git a/hosts/t490/services/redshift.nix b/hosts/t490/services/redshift.nix deleted file mode 100644 index f7e3bc71..00000000 --- a/hosts/t490/services/redshift.nix +++ /dev/null @@ -1,31 +0,0 @@ -{ config, lib, ... }: - -with lib; - -let - cfg = config.redshift; -in -{ - options.redshift.enable = mkEnableOption "Enable redshift"; - - config = mkIf cfg.enable { - location = { - latitude = 51.48; - longitude = -3.17; - }; - - services.redshift = { - enable = true; - - brightness = { - day = "1"; - night = "1"; - }; - - temperature = { - day = 5500; - night = 3700; - }; - }; - }; -} diff --git a/modules/home-manager/default.nix b/modules/home-manager/default.nix index 559ce816..7fe7ca72 100644 --- a/modules/home-manager/default.nix +++ b/modules/home-manager/default.nix @@ -8,7 +8,6 @@ ./gtk.nix ./media/handbrake.nix ./node.nix - ./redshift.nix ./starship.nix ./zsh ]; diff --git a/modules/home-manager/redshift.nix b/modules/home-manager/redshift.nix deleted file mode 100644 index 8a864d10..00000000 --- a/modules/home-manager/redshift.nix +++ /dev/null @@ -1,19 +0,0 @@ -{ config, lib, ... }: - -let - cfg = config.features.desktop.redshift; - - inherit (lib) mkEnableOption mkIf; -in -{ - options.features.desktop.redshift = { - enable = mkEnableOption "Enable redshift"; - }; - - config = mkIf cfg.enable { - services.redshift.enable = true; - - services.redshift.latitude = "51.58"; - services.redshift.longitude = "-2.99"; - }; -} diff --git a/modules2/redshift.nix b/modules2/redshift.nix new file mode 100644 index 00000000..da5c942d --- /dev/null +++ b/modules2/redshift.nix @@ -0,0 +1,8 @@ +{ + flake.modules.homeManager.gui.services.redshift = { + enable = true; + + latitude = "51.58"; + longitude = "-2.99"; + }; +}